Lifelike Flame Effects
Without flames in real life electric fireplaces need to create the illusion of a flame display that can attract. Some models utilize mirrors and LED lights to create the motion of flames. Other models include a water vapor system which replicates smoke and other effects. Some of these systems such as the Opti-Myst technology used in the Dimplex 28-Inch Opti Myst Electric Log and Fireplace Insert Set make one of the most realistic and believable flame displays on the market.
These systems can even mimic the look of a fire that is burning in wood and help you to create the look you desire in your home. The LED lights change colors as programmed, and some utilize a series of mirrors to add depth and a three-dimensional effect. This makes them a great choice for those who appreciate the flicker and glow of a fire but do not want the mess, smoke, or safety hazards that are associated with traditional fireplaces.
As manufacturers try to create more lifelike illusions, the technology behind these flame effects has developed dramatically. Many of these fireplaces have a holographic fire effect which projects videos of actual flames onto the logs. This kind of effect gives the most realistic and authentic flame display, however it can also be somewhat more expensive than other options.
Many manufacturers offer a vast range of flame colors and other effects to satisfy different tastes, and they have created methods that allow you to alter the settings separately from the heat. This feature is perfect for those who wish to enjoy the warmth of a flame, but without the heat. It's ideal if you have children or pets in the house.
Some of these units have a special flame effect that is caused by infrared light which is invisible to the human eye however it warms objects and people just as sunlight does. This type of heat is less harsh than conventional electric heaters and is often referred to as "peaceful" due to the fact that it doesn't overheat the air or dry it out.
The MagikFlame system used by the GreatCo Linear Wall Mount Electric Fireplace is an exclusive infrared-quartz heating component that produces light in the invisible infrared region that can be felt but not seen. This kind of heat is more comfortable to touch than other electric heaters, and is also one of the most efficient types of heat. This model doesn't require a chimney or clearances, and is very easy to install and use.

Easy to Use
Electric fires offer the comfort and visual appeal of a fireplace without the hassle of flues, chimneys or professional installation. They also cost significantly less than gas fireplaces in terms of operating costs -- on average it costs only 3 cents per hour to operate the flames and 9 cents when the heater is turned on. Since they shut off and on automatically based on the thermostat, it's more cost effective to utilize the heating option only when you need it.
The convenience of electric fires can be especially welcome in homes with children. Since the flames aren't hot, they eliminate some of the burn risks that come with open or gas fires. Electric fires are a great option for families with young children, although they still require supervision and attention.

In addition to offering an alternative that is safe to traditional wood-burning fireplaces, electric fires are simple to maintain and clean. Many models have an easy dusting mode that blows out the internal components to eliminate any built-up ash and dust. Other models have removable front panels that make cleaning easier.
